@pytest.mark.parametrize("num_rows", NUM_ROWS)
@pytest.mark.parametrize("top_k", [512, 2048])
@pytest.mark.skipif(not current_platform.is_cuda(), reason="This test requires CUDA")
@torch.inference_mode()
def test_top_k_per_row_prefill_torch_fallback(
num_rows: int,
top_k: int,
) -> None:
"""The SM12x torch fallback honors top_k_per_row_prefill's contract:
the top-k positions of logits[i, ks_i:ke_i) relative to ks_i, in
ascending position order, -1-padded when a row has fewer candidates,
with NaN scores never selected."""
from vllm.model_executor.layers.sparse_attn_indexer import (
_top_k_per_row_prefill_torch,
)

set_random_seed(0)
torch.set_default_device("cuda:0")

vocab_size = 20000
row_starts, row_ends = create_row_boundaries(num_rows, vocab_size)
logits = create_random_logits(
row_starts, row_ends, torch.float32, 42, True, "random"
)
# Sprinkle NaNs inside some valid spans: the fallback must skip them
# (the failure mode on SM12x is NaN-dominated logits).
if num_rows > 2:
logits[2, : int(row_ends[2])] = float("nan")

indices = torch.empty((num_rows, top_k), dtype=torch.int32, device="cuda")
# The fallback masks logits in place; give it a scratch copy.
_top_k_per_row_prefill_torch(
logits.clone(), row_starts, row_ends, indices, top_k
)

for i in range(num_rows):
row_start = int(row_starts[i])
row_end = int(row_ends[i])
row = indices[i].cpu()
finite = torch.isfinite(logits[i, row_start:row_end]).sum().item()
num_valid = min(top_k, int(finite))
selected = row[:num_valid]
# Ascending position order, in range, no duplicates.
assert (selected.diff() > 0).all(), f"row {i} not ascending"
assert (selected >= 0).all() and (selected < row_end - row_start).all()
# Everything past the valid entries is -1 padding.
assert (row[num_valid:] == -1).all(), f"row {i} padding broken"
# Set-equality with the torch.topk reference over the valid span.
if num_valid:
span = logits[i, row_start:row_end].nan_to_num(float("-inf"))
ref = span.topk(num_valid, dim=-1)[1].cpu()
assert set(selected.tolist()) == set(ref.tolist()), (
f"row {i} selected wrong candidate set"
)

def _top_k_per_row_prefill_torch(
logits: torch.Tensor,
cu_seqlen_ks: torch.Tensor,
cu_seqlen_ke: torch.Tensor,
topk_indices: torch.Tensor,
topk_tokens: int,
) -> None:
"""torch.topk fallback with ``top_k_per_row_prefill``'s output contract.

On SM12x the CUDA kernel's histogram path (taken by rows with more than
``topk_tokens`` candidates) can leave part of its dynamic-shared-memory
output uninitialized and copy it out as indices; downstream,
``compute_global_topk_indices_and_lens`` treats any index ``>= 0`` as
valid and dereferences it into the KV block table, crashing with a CUDA
illegal memory access. Until the kernel is fixed for SM12x, select the
top ``topk_tokens`` positions of ``logits[i, ks_i:ke_i)`` per row with
torch.topk, emit them relative to ``ks_i`` in ascending position order,
and pad rows with fewer candidates with ``-1`` (the kernel's short-row
contract).
"""
num_cols = logits.shape[1]
ks = cu_seqlen_ks.to(torch.long)[:, None]
cols = torch.arange(num_cols, device=logits.device)[None, :]
valid = (cols >= ks) & (cols < cu_seqlen_ke.to(torch.long)[:, None])
# logits is a per-chunk scratch buffer that is dead after top-k; mask it
# in place rather than materializing a masked copy.
logits.masked_fill_(~valid, float("-inf"))
k = min(topk_tokens, num_cols)
top_values, top_cols = logits.topk(k, dim=-1)
relative = (top_cols - ks).to(torch.int32)
# Downstream sparse-attention kernels iterate the selected KV positions
# in ascending order; emit position-sorted indices with the ``-1`` pads
# at the tail (torch.topk returns score order instead). Non-finite
# scores (rows shorter than ``topk_tokens``, or NaN logits) pad.
pad_sentinel = torch.iinfo(torch.int32).max
relative = torch.where(
top_values.isfinite(), relative, relative.new_full((), pad_sentinel)
)
relative, _ = relative.sort(dim=-1)
relative = torch.where(
relative == pad_sentinel, relative.new_full((), -1), relative
)
topk_indices[:, :k] = relative
if k < topk_tokens:
topk_indices[:, k:] = -1
